“Vighnanz- The Band” celebrated the success of the Slow Romantic Music video – “TOH BINA”   

 

Bhubaneswar:26/10/17: Vighnanz The Band, originating from Odisha have been continuously performing Odisha since 7 years, recently has launched their new Single Music Video – “TOH BINA” onAmara Muzik platsforms.  The Single Music Video is crafted inassociation with Basudev Films & Prelude Production. The album is releasedon Odisha’s Leading Music Label – “Amara Muzik”. The album is under the banner of “Vighnanz- The Band”, “Basudev Films”& “Prelude Production”. The romantic Odia trackmakes a record by crossing 2 lakhs views in a span of 36 hrs. The Musical video is based on love at first sight depicting typically terrace love.

TOH BINA” brings together for the first time Odia Industry’s fresh pair Raj Rajesh and Sradha Panigrahi along with Subhasis Panda. The duo is seen on the direction of well known Video Director –Basudev Dalai, who is also on DOP and Screenplay. Cinematography has been done by Anurag Das. Director Dalai said, “TOH BINA is a simple day to day love story, pulled on terrace, galis (Lanes) of Cuttack. We have tried to show regular love building between a young couple, “that  knid of teen love story.” Its impulse, annoyance, ignorance, cuteness, shyness, innocence blended has resulted in TOH BINA”. Lyricist S K Jabid Ali, who has written for many well known Odia tracks, also gave his soulful lyrics in this romantic track. The track is composed by “Vighnanz- The Band” and “Nabs & Saroj” and sung by the lead performer Durga.
